Is Sons of the Forest on Steam Deck?
As of writing, Sons of the Forest is listed as unsupported by Valve for the Steam Deck.While you can still play the game, what “unsupported” means is that Valve thinks the Steam Deck is not the right way to experience Sons of the Forest.
Players have found the game crashes when building, while FPS drops are frequent when a lot of enemies and objects appear on the screen. If that wasn’t bad enough, there are also a number of audio issues present when playing on Steam Deck.
This can obviously lead to a lot of immersion-breaking moments that ruin the overall experience. As a result, we recommend playing Sons of the Forest on PC or waiting for a future Steam Deck patch that helps alleviate these issues.
